Week 3 Tutorial Logbook - 14/10

In preparation for the third tutorial we had to create a pitch for “The Candidate”. The Candidate are a company looking for ways to grow their online presence in IT recruitment in the North West. As a group we met up during the week to discuss pitch ideas and presentation formats, by Wednesday the 12th we had our pitch complete and ready to be sent to Dr Bex.

During the actual tutorial a total of 11 groups pitched their ideas and luckily enough we were the only group pitching to The Candidate. I feel that our pitch went well, it contained a sufficient amount of information but it could have been better. In comparison to other pitches I feel that we lacked actual creative ideas, as we took the approach of informing the audience of who we were as a group.


Through watching everyone else pitch, I feel that I’ve learnt a great deal about what to include in a pitch. I now know what to add to make it appropriate. But all in all, it was a good first try as we succeeded in securing the project. We, as a group are delighted to be working with The Candidate.
